 | '''Tool for parsing a list of projects to determine if they are Zephyr | 
 | projects. If no projects are given then the output from `west list` will be | 
 | used as project list. | 
 |  | 
 | Include file is generated for Kconfig using --kconfig-out. | 
 | A <name>:<path> text file is generated for use with CMake using --cmake-out. | 
 |  | 
 | Using --twister-out <filename> an argument file for twister script will | 
 | be generated which would point to test and sample roots available in modules | 
 | that can be included during a twister run. This allows testing code | 
 | maintained in modules in addition to what is available in the main Zephyr tree. | 
 | ''' |

 | def parse_modules(zephyr_base, manifest=None, west_projs=None, modules=None, | 
 |                   extra_modules=None): | 
 |  | 
 |     if modules is None: | 
 |         west_projs = west_projs or west_projects(manifest) | 
 |         modules = ([p.posixpath for p in west_projs['projects']] | 
 |                    if west_projs else []) | 
 |  | 
 |     if extra_modules is None: | 
 |         extra_modules = [] | 
 |  | 
 |     Module = namedtuple('Module', ['project', 'meta', 'depends']) | 
 |  | 
 |     all_modules_by_name = {} | 
 |     # dep_modules is a list of all modules that has an unresolved dependency | 
 |     dep_modules = [] | 
 |     # start_modules is a list modules with no depends left (no incoming edge) | 
 |     start_modules = [] | 
 |     # sorted_modules is a topological sorted list of the modules | 
 |     sorted_modules = [] | 
 |  | 
 |     for project in modules + extra_modules: | 
 |         # Avoid including Zephyr base project as module. | 
 |         if project == zephyr_base: | 
 |             continue | 
 |  | 
 |         meta = process_module(project) | 
 |         if meta: | 
 |             depends = meta.get('build', {}).get('depends', []) | 
 |             all_modules_by_name[meta['name']] = Module(project, meta, depends) | 
 |  | 
 |         elif project in extra_modules: | 
 |             sys.exit(f'{project}, given in ZEPHYR_EXTRA_MODULES, ' | 
 |                      'is not a valid zephyr module') | 
 |  | 
 |     for module in all_modules_by_name.values(): | 
 |         if not module.depends: | 
 |             start_modules.append(module) | 
 |         else: | 
 |             dep_modules.append(module) | 
 |  | 
 |     # This will do a topological sort to ensure the modules are ordered | 
 |     # according to dependency settings. | 
 |     while start_modules: | 
 |         node = start_modules.pop(0) | 
 |         sorted_modules.append(node) | 
 |         node_name = node.meta['name'] | 
 |         to_remove = [] | 
 |         for module in dep_modules: | 
 |             if node_name in module.depends: | 
 |                 module.depends.remove(node_name) | 
 |                 if not module.depends: | 
 |                     start_modules.append(module) | 
 |                     to_remove.append(module) | 
 |         for module in to_remove: | 
 |             dep_modules.remove(module) | 
 |  | 
 |     if dep_modules: | 
 |         # If there are any modules with unresolved dependencies, then the | 
 |         # modules contains unmet or cyclic dependencies. Error out. | 
 |         error = 'Unmet or cyclic dependencies in modules:\n' | 
 |         for module in dep_modules: | 
 |             error += f'{module.project} depends on: {module.depends}\n' | 
 |         sys.exit(error) | 
 |  | 
 |     return sorted_modules |
